Abstract
680,504. Resilient mountings for seats. PADST, H. Oct. 31, 1950 [Oct. 31, 1949], No. 26590/50. Class 52(i) [Also in Groups XXXI and XXXII] A support 3 for a resilient, yieldable seat comprises superposed. co-extensive leaf springs 4 clamped together at their ends which are secured to the seat 1 and seat holder 2, respectively. As applied to a bicycle saddle, Fig. 2, the support 3 is clamped in bearings 8, 9 by screws 6 and 7. The seat holder 2 and seat 1 present paths of contact 10, 11 respectively for the support 3. The support 3 may comprise two outer leaf springs of spring metal and an inner leaf spring of wood. Fig. 5 shows two wooden leaf springs 4c, the thickness of the springs decreasing towards the centre of their length. The springs may be cut away in the centre or at one side, one leaf spring being superposed in such a manner that the cutaway portions of successive leaf springs are at opposite sides.
